06 Sep Uniswap Platform-Slippage-Adjustment-to minimize-Costs
Setup Uniswap API Key for Simplified Swap Management
Secure your trading experience by setting up an Uniswap API key right away. This straightforward guide will enhance your interaction with the Uniswap decentralized exchange (DEX) and streamline your swap management process. With the API, you gain access to helpful features such as live charts and graphs that display trade volumes, token pairs, and fee structures.
Start by registering on the Uniswap platform to generate your API key. This key will allow you to connect seamlessly with the Uniswap interface. By utilizing the API, you can monitor market levels, execute trades, and manage contracts with greater efficiency. Keep your API key safe to maintain the security of your transactions.
The interactive UI of the Uniswap DEX is one of its strong points. You can view price movements and trends, enabling you to choose the best path for your trades. Using the API, automate your trading strategies based on real-time data without manually checking the platform constantly. By optimizing your swap management, you not only save time but also potentially reduce trading fees.
Creating Your Uniswap Account and API Key
Begin by visiting the Uniswap portal to create your account. Select the “Connect Wallet” option to link your existing crypto wallet, such as MetaMask or Coinbase Wallet. This link establishes a secure connection, allowing you to access the dapp and interact with the Uniswap platform.
Once connected, navigate to the dashboard. Here, you will find various charts and options for tracking liquidity pairs (LP) and fees associated with swaps. To manage your activities seamlessly, locate the API management panel within your account settings.
Follow these steps to generate your API key:
- Click on “API Keys” in the account settings.
- Select “Create New Key” to initiate the process.
- Designate a name for your key to organize your usage.
- Set permissions based on your intended use, including options for instant swaps or data retrieval.
- Click “Generate” and securely store your key in a safe location.
Your API key enables instant access to various routes and behaviors of the Uniswap contracts. Utilize it for automated trades, retrieving price data, or managing liquidity positions. Monitor your gas fees closely to ensure optimal transaction flow when interacting with the network.
In the future, always refer back to your dashboard for real-time updates and insights on the performance of your selected assets, including ETH and UNI. Adjust your API settings as necessary to fit your changing needs within the DeFi landscape.
Understanding API Key Permissions for Swap Operations
Set clear permissions when generating your API key for Uniswap to ensure optimal swap management. Different permission levels grant specific access to swap features, so specify what you need for your dApp. Most swaps will require permissions that allow market execution and trading capabilities.
Monitor transaction activity with real-time data analysis through your API. Utilize the built-in charts and explorers to track swap performance and market trends effectively. For instance, you can analyze ETH liquidity pools to determine the best times for executing trades.
Connector functionality allows rapid integration with different DeFi protocols. Ensure that your API key has permissions to interact with these connectors, enabling quick execution of trades across various markets. This integration will simplify your workflow, making transaction management seamless.
When executing limit orders, verify your settings within the API. Permissions must align with your intended trading style, whether that be aggressive trading or more conservative limit setups. Adjust these settings in your panel according to market conditions for optimized performance.
Engage with the API documentation to familiarize yourself with contract interaction specifics. Knowing how to structure your requests can significantly enhance your execution speed, improving your ability to capitalize on market movements.
Review all permissions assigned to your key periodically. Make adjustments as your trading strategy evolves, ensuring that access levels remain appropriate and secure. By maintaining control over your API key permissions, you’ll streamline your swap operations within the Uniswap ecosystem.
Integrating Uniswap API into Your Trading Application
Begin by obtaining your Uniswap API key. This key is crucial for establishing a secure connection to the API, ensuring smooth operation within your application.
Next, set up a user-friendly interface where users can manage their liquidity positions (LPs) and conduct swaps. Utilize the API’s endpoints to fetch real-time stats on token prices, liquidity, and transaction volumes.
Implement a flexible config panel within your application. This allows users to set their preferred trading parameters, including limit orders and fee structures. Make sure to integrate token routes manually based on the latest market data to enhance trading efficiency.
Your application should feature interactive charts for users to analyze market trends. Leverage the API to update these charts with real-time data, enhancing decision-making for trading strategies.
Ensure proper security measures are in place. Utilize meta transactions to allow users to interact with smart contracts securely. This will safeguard users from potential vulnerabilities within the blockchain environment.
Integrate a connector to directly interface with Uniswap contracts. This functionality streamlines the swapping process, allowing users to quickly execute their trades without unnecessary delays.
Finally, implement an explorer feature that provides users with real-time insights into their transactions and liquidity pools. This feature enhances user engagement and fosters transparency within your trading application.
Executing Quick Trades with Uniswap API
To execute quick trades on Uniswap, first ensure your wallet is connected to the Uniswap interface. This setup allows seamless interaction with the liquidity pools and trading features. Begin your trading journey by selecting the appropriate token pairing. The real-time price chart offers a clear view of market behavior and trading routes.
Utilize the Uniswap API to auto-generate trade paths, increasing the speed and efficiency of your transactions. Filtering options enable users to analyze the optimal routes while keeping an eye on fees associated with each trade. Pay attention to liquidity depth; higher liquidity typically results in lower slippage during execution.
For a smooth experience, leverage the interactive trading panel that Uniswap provides. This panel helps in making split-second decisions while ensuring top-tier security for your funds. Always monitor the price flow and make informed decisions based on market analysis.
For those trading ETH or any other token, utilize the Uni token as you interact with liquidity providers (LP). This aspect enhances your trading style while managing expenses and maximizing earnings. Stay informed by checking the latest updates on the uniswap exchange, where you can find essential information to help you navigate your trades effectively.
Monitoring Liquidity Pools for Optimal Trade Execution
Utilize a real-time analysis panel to keep track of liquidity pools effectively. By connecting to a reliable API, you can fetch immediate stats on available liquidity and transaction fees across different DEXs. Monitoring these metrics allows for quick decision-making when executing swaps.
Focus on key indicators like price, liquidity flow, and potential routes for execution. Use an estimator tool to assess the potential impact of your trades. This helps you to select the best path for optimal trade execution on Uniswap or other exchanges.
Liquidity Pool | Price | Fee | Available Liquidity |
---|---|---|---|
ETH/USDT | $3,000 | 0.3% | 500 ETH |
BTC/USDT | $40,000 | 0.5% | 200 BTC |
UNI/USDT | $25 | 0.3% | 1,000 UNI |
Always maintain awareness of your transaction’s flow. Ensure your browser refreshes the data frequently to capture any changes. Select appropriate options to execute your trades seamlessly. Leverage the connector feature in the API to streamline this process for multiple contracts.
Regularly analyze the liquidity levels and price fluctuations in the market. This ongoing process equips you with insights to adjust your strategy promptly, thus enhancing your trading performance in the crypto space.
Troubleshooting Common Issues with Uniswap API Setup
Ensure your API key is correctly configured in your project. Incorrect configurations can lead to erroneous behavior in your dashboard. Double-check the access permissions to confirm your account can interact with the required endpoints.
Monitor your gas fees during transactions. High gas prices can disrupt the flow of trades, impacting liquidity and causing delays in token swaps. Using real-time gas price tools helps optimize your transactions.
If the connector appears unresponsive, verify the integration settings. Restart your application and inspect the logic behind API calls to ensure proper execution. Review error messages for insights into specific failures.
When analyzing price data, be aware of possible discrepancies between your toolkit and the live Uniswap interface. Cross-reference volume figures to validate transaction data accuracy.
Switch between light and dark mode when using the interactive dashboard to improve visibility. This simple adjustment can enhance user experience, especially during extensive analysis sessions.
In case of token retrieval issues, confirm that the token addresses are up to date. Keeping an updated list of supported tokens will streamline the swap management process.
If interactions are limited, consider re-evaluating your config settings. Ensure API limits are not being hit, and that your application stays responsive to user commands.
Should persistent issues arise, refer to community forums for similar cases. Engaging with other developers can provide practical solutions and additional help.
Q&A:
How do I set up an API key for Uniswap?
To set up an API key for Uniswap, first, navigate to the Uniswap interface and create an account. Once your account is created, head to the API section of the platform. Here, you will find an option to generate a new API key. Follow the prompts to create your key, ensuring you save it securely as it will be required for making calls to the Uniswap API. Make sure to review any usage guidelines associated with the API key to avoid unnecessary charges.
What steps do I need to follow for using the Uniswap API effectively?
After obtaining your API key, you can start using the Uniswap API by integrating it with your application. First, familiarize yourself with the API documentation which outlines the available endpoints and their functionalities. Write code to make requests to these endpoints, utilizing your API key for authentication. Test your integration thoroughly to ensure it responds accurately to the requests. Additionally, monitor your API usage to stay within the allocated limits and optimize your calls for better performance.
Can you explain how the fee estimator works in the Uniswap browser wallet?
The fee estimator in the Uniswap browser wallet calculates the transaction fees based on the current network conditions and the selected token swap. When you initiate a swap, the wallet accesses real-time data to provide an estimate of the gas fees required for the transaction to be processed on the Ethereum network. This allows users to understand the costs involved before confirming the transaction, helping them make informed decisions about when to execute their swaps.
What should I consider while estimating fees for swaps on Uniswap?
When estimating fees for swaps on Uniswap, consider factors like current gas prices, the size of the transaction, and the type of tokens you are swapping. Gas prices fluctuate based on network congestion, so it’s wise to check current rates using a gas tracker. Larger or more complex transactions might incur higher fees as they require more processing power. Additionally, be aware of slippage — the difference between the expected price of a swap and the actual price after the transaction is executed, which can affect your overall cost.
Is it necessary to have a separate wallet for interacting with Uniswap?
While it is not strictly necessary to have a separate wallet to interact with Uniswap, it is highly recommended. Using a dedicated wallet can enhance security, separating your funds used for trading from those held for other purposes. Wallets like MetaMask or Trust Wallet are popular choices as they integrate well with the Uniswap interface. This separation also allows for better management of transaction fees and makes it easier to track your trading activities.
How do I set up an API key for Uniswap to manage swaps?
To set up an API key for Uniswap, you first need to create an account on the Uniswap platform or any supported developer portal that provides API access. After successfully registering, navigate to the API section of your account settings. Here, you will find an option to generate a new API key. Make sure to store the key securely, as it will be required for making requests to the Uniswap API. Once you have your key, you can start integrating it into your applications for swap management and various other functionalities offered by Uniswap.
No Comments